Output 607599a5106d5e795bedcfa6818772932e958fb53dd2ed55b52f59027fe3e858:1

value
2910551
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6a814a710198ab29a2b6760e0f9faa7698c6ac16 OP_EQUAL
address
3BQASABasHTzfnyrW5cQrdQ2bMErESm7j4
transaction
607599a5106d5e795bedcfa6818772932e958fb53dd2ed55b52f59027fe3e858
spent
true